Best Things to Do on a Kanazawa Vacation
There's so much to explore in Kanazawa. Take a look at the list below and get inspired to plan your journey.
- Visit the iconic Kenrokuen Garden, one of Japan’s most famous gardens, known for its beauty and seasonal flowers.
- Explore the charming streets of the Higashi Chaya District, a historic area with traditional teahouses and shops.
- Discover the rich history at the Kanazawa Castle, featuring beautiful grounds and reconstructed structures from the Edo period.
- Stroll through the picturesque Nagamachi Samurai District, home to historic samurai residences and museums.
- Visit the stunning 21st Century Museum of Contemporary Art, showcasing modern works by Japanese and international artists.
- Experience the vibrant local culture and cuisine at the Omicho Market, offering fresh seafood and regional specialties.
- Savor traditional Japanese dishes, including sushi and kaiseki, at local restaurants and izakayas.
- Take a day trip to the nearby Shirakawa-go, a UNESCO World Heritage site known for its traditional gassho-zukuri farmhouses.
- Explore the art and culture at the Ishikawa Prefectural Museum of Art, featuring a collection of regional and national artworks.
- Enjoy a scenic walk along the Asanogawa River for views of Kanazawa’s historic landmarks and natural beauty.
